About the Business

Latinos Cuisine is a vibrant and authentic restaurant located in the bustling Crossgates Mall Road in Albany, New York. Our menu is inspired by the rich and diverse flavors of Latin American cuisine, offering a delicious array of dishes that will tantalize your taste buds. From traditional favorites like empanadas and arroz con pollo to mouthwatering tacos and ceviche, our chefs use only the freshest ingredients to create a dining experience that is both flavorful and memorable. Come and experience the warmth and hospitality of Latinos Cuisine as you indulge in a culinary journey through the vibrant flavors of Latin America.

Amanda Maldonado:
5

"Hands down best Puerto Rican food in the capital region. Too bad they're hidden in the mall. Wish they'd get more attention from customers. I've visited a couple of times and wish i could eat here more often. So far my husband and i have tried the pasteles with white rice and a side of beans, the pernil with yellow rice and recently had their mofongo with Carne frita. All of which make my homesick taste buds dance and sing. Wash it down with a Kola Champagne and you're set! I'm a Chicago native and have struggled the last several years without some good home cooking. This place really hits the spot. One thing I will note is the empanadas we had were not the greatest. But the solution? Try something else! Explore the menu! I can't wait to try more items on their menu."
